I consider myself skilled at applying polish, but Essie Urban Jungle is one of the streakiest, most difficult polishes I have used. It pools at the cuticles and streaks on the way up. Careful as I was, I just couldn’t get a perfectly smooth, even edge at the cuticle line. It took three painstakingly-applied coats to get it opaque and acceptable looking (photo above). I feel like I used up half the bottle on this one manicure!
I just can’t see myself using this polish again. It was frustrating to use and I just know I won’t have the time to apply it properly when I’m rushing to getting ready.
The color is whiter than I was expecting. It has a pale pink undertone. This is not really what I was expecting based on photos I had seen online, including Essie’s website. I expected it to have a more gray or beige undertone, but unfortunately it didn’t.
